The Objective and Rules of Blackjack
The primary objective of blackjack is to beat the dealer by having a hand value closer to 21 without going over. Each player is dealt two cards, and the dealer also receives two cards, usually with one face-up and one face-down. Players can choose to “hit” (take another card) or “stand” (keep their current total), and can continue to hit until they either stand or bust (exceed 21).
Deck Composition and Card Values
Blackjack is typically played with one or more standard 52-card decks. Card values are as follows: cards 2 through 10 hold their face value, while jacks, queens, and kings are worth 10 points, and aces can be worth either 1 or 11 points, depending on which value is more beneficial for the player. Understanding these values and how to calculate your hand’s total is crucial for developing effective strategies.
Basic Blackjack Strategies
To increase the chances of winning, players should learn the basic strategies for blackjack, which include knowing when to hit, stand, double down, or split pairs. For example, a common strategy is to always split aces and eights, but never split tens or fives. Using a basic strategy chart can help players make the most optimal choices based on their hand and the dealer’s visible card.

Card Counting Fundamentals
Card counting is a technique that allows players to track the ratio of high-value cards to low-value cards remaining in the deck. By assigning a value to each card—typically, low cards (2-6) are given a value of +1, high cards (10-A) a value of -1, and neutral cards (7-9) a value of 0—players can maintain a running count that helps them determine when to increase their bets. While effective, card counting requires practice and precision.
Betting Systems and Strategies
Various betting systems, such as the Martingale, Fibonacci, and Labouchere, can be utilized in blackjack. These systems dictate how players should manage their bets after wins and losses. The idea behind these strategies is to maximize winnings and minimize losses by adjusting bet sizes based on previous results. However, it’s essential to understand that no betting system can eliminate the house edge; they only manage how wagers are placed over time.

Understanding House Edge and Player Advantage
The house edge in blackjack refers to the statistical advantage that the casino has over the players. This edge typically ranges from 0.5% to 1% with optimal play, making blackjack one of the more favorable games for players compared to slots and roulette. Understanding the house edge allows players to make informed decisions about their gameplay and recognize the importance of strategic betting.
